Why term life insurance wins for mortgage protection

Lender mortgage insurance is underwritten after a claim, meaning your family could be denied at the worst possible moment. Term life insurance is fully underwritten upfront, and the payout goes directly to your family so they can pay off the mortgage, cover living expenses, and make their own decisions.
